This domain, stellar-community-fund-next.pages.dev, was created on 9 November 2023 and is registered through Cloudflare, Inc. The authoritative nameservers are elisa.ns.cloudflare.com and ezra.ns.cloudflare.com, both owned by Cloudflare. DNS resolution points to IP address 172.66.44.80, which belongs to AS13335 Cloudflare, Inc., and is geolocated in the United States. The web server returns HTTP status code 403 and presents the page title “Suspected phishing site | Cloudflare”. Automated analysis assigns a Gridinsoft trust score of 0 out of 100, indicating an extremely low confidence in the site’s legitimacy. VirusTotal has flagged the domain in five of ninety‑four scanned security vendors, confirming that multiple detection engines consider it malicious.
The site’s technology stack includes Node.js, React, Next.js, Webpack, HTTP/3, and HSTS, all delivered via Cloudflare’s edge network, which further obscures the underlying hosting environment. The domain is explicitly listed as impersonating the Cloudflare brand, and it appears on three external blocklists. It has been added to the blocklists maintained by PhishDestroy, MetaMask, and SEAL, and is currently marked as active. No publicly available SSL certificate details are provided beyond the fact that the domain is served through Cloudflare, which typically enforces HTTPS. The available evidence does not disclose any additional payloads, credential‑harvesting forms, or redirect behavior beyond the HTTP 403 response.
Analysts should treat this domain as high‑risk infrastructure used to lure victims by masquerading as an official Cloudflare resource. Defensive recommendations include adding the domain and its IP address to web‑filter blocklists, enforcing DNS‑based blocking for the identified nameservers, and monitoring outbound traffic for connections to 172.66.44.80.
